The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jul. 02, 2024

Filed:

May. 21, 2021
Applicant:

Huawei Technologies Co., Ltd., Guangdong, CN;

Inventors:

Zhou Hong, Santa Clara, CA (US);

Yufei Zhang, Santa Clara, CA (US);

Assignee:
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06T 1/60 (2006.01); G06F 17/15 (2006.01); G06T 1/20 (2006.01); G06T 3/18 (2024.01); G06T 15/00 (2011.01);
U.S. Cl.
CPC ...
G06T 1/60 (2013.01); G06F 17/153 (2013.01); G06T 1/20 (2013.01); G06T 3/18 (2024.01); G06T 15/005 (2013.01);
Abstract

The disclosed technology relates to graphics processing units (GPU), In one aspect, a GPU includes a general purpose register (GPR) including registers, an arithmetic logic unit (ALU) reading pixels of an image independently of a shared memory, and a level 1 (L1) cache storing pixels to implement a pixel mapping that maps the pixels read from the L1 cache into the registers of the GPR. The pixel mapping includes separating pixels of an image into three regions, with each region including a set of pixels. A first and second set of the pixels are loaded into registers corresponding to two of the three regions horizontally, and a third set of the pixels are loaded into registers corresponding to the third of the three regions vertically. Each of the registers in the first, second, and third registers are loaded as a contiguous ordered number of registers in the GPR.


Find Patent Forward Citations

Loading…